Andrew B. Wetzel

Principal, Portfolio Manager at FLP

Mr. Wetzel, a CFA® charterholder, is responsible for management of the firm’s Sustainable Opportunities and Fossil Fuel Free – Low Carbon Equity Strategies. Mr. Wetzel also oversees the firm’s research efforts, from fundamental security, sector, market and thematic work to the integration of ESG analysis throughout the investment process.

Since joining F.L.Putnam in 2003, Andrew has been involved in all aspects of the firm’s investment process from fundamental research to portfolio management. As a Portfolio Manager, Andrew has focused on fundamental active equity management with a specialization in sustainable investing. Throughout his career with the firm, Andrew has helped clients align their investment portfolios with their values or missions and has guided F.L.Putnam’s approach through an increasingly complex sustainable investing landscape.

Andrew is an active member of the CFA Society of Boston, in a leadership role focused on the Society’s Sustainable Investing Initiative. Andrew also serves on the Finance and Sustainability Committee at Roca, Inc., a non-profit focused on reducing recidivism in populations of the highest risk young men in eastern and central MA and Baltimore, MD.
